@CHARSET "UTF-8";
.top, .menu, .banner, .logomaquee, .content, .bottom{
	width:100%;
	border:0px solid green;
}
.bigdiv{
width:930px;
margin: 0 auto;
}
.top{
	height:96px;
}
.top img{
	padding-left:20px;
}

.menu{
	height:35px;
	width:932px;
}
.menu .mleft{
	width:5px;
	height:35px;
	background:url(../images/pu.png);
	background-position:-1px 0px;
	float:left;
}
.menu .mright{
	width:195px;
	height:35px;
	background:url(../images/pu.png);
	background-position:0px -35px;
	float:right;
}
.menu .mcent{
	width:732px;
	height:35px;
	background:url(../images/pu_r2_c1.jpg) repeat-x;
	float:left;
	overflow:hidden;
}
.banner{
	height:340px;
	width:932px;
	overflow:hidden;
	border-bottom:3px solid #ED6517;
	background:#410042;
		
}
.banner img{
 width:100%;
 heigt:100%;
 display:block;
}
.logomaquee{
	height:70px;
	text-align:center;
	border-bottom:1px solid #F9D0BA;
	overflow: hidden;
}
.logomaquee img{
	margin-top:15px;
}

.content{
	height:270px;
	overflow:hidden;
}
.contenttab{
	width:100%;margin:0 auto;
}
.contenttab .t1{
	width:60px; height:21px; background:url(../images/about_3_r8_c4.jpg) no-repeat center;text-align:center;
	color:#FFFFFF;font-weight:bold;
}
.contenttab .t2{
	width:800px; height:21px;text-align: left;
}


.content .cleft{
	width:605px;
	height:98%;
	border-right:1px solid #F9D0BA;
	float:left;
}
.cleft span{
	font-weight:bold;
	font-size:14px;
}

.ban{
	width:932px;
	height:107px;
	background:url(../images/news_1_r3_c2.jpg);
	margin-top:20px;
}
.content .cleft .ltop{
	width:585px;
	height:37px;
	background:url(../images/index_r2_c2.jpg);
	margin-top:20px;
	
}
.content .cleft .textcent{
	width:560px;
	margin:0 auto;
	height:37px;
	margin-top:30px;
	
}


.content .cright{
	width:320px;
	height:98%;
	border:0px solid red;
	float:right;
}
.content .cright .rtop{
	width:300px;
	height:37px;
	float:right;
	background:url(../images/index_r2_c4.jpg);
	margin-top:20px;
	cursor:pointer;
}
.content .cright .centrig{
	width:280px;
	height:auto;
	margin:0 auto;
	overflow:hidden;
	margin-top:10px;
}
.content .cright .centrig span{
	color: #ED6F27;
	font-size:12px;
	font-weight:bold;
}

.bottom{
	height:70px;
	background:#EEEEEE;
	margin-top:10px;
}
.contenx{
	border:1px solid #F1D5C7;
	width:310px;
	height:215px;
	float:left;
	border-bottom:0px;
}
.contenx .c1{
	width:260px;
	height:30px;
	margin:0 auto;
	margin-top:25px;
	font-size:16px;
	font-weight:bold;
	color:#303030;
	
}
.contenx .c2{
	width:260px;
	height:110px;
	margin:0 auto;
	background:url(../images/about_1_r8dc3.jpg) no-repeat top left;
}
.c2 .ctext{
	width:120px;height:110px;float:right;
	margin-top:10px;
	word-break:break-all;
	line-height:20px;
	overflow:hidden;
}
.contenx .c3{
	border:0px solid #F1D5C7;
	width:260px;
	height:30px;
	margin:0 auto;
	margin-top:5px;
	text-align:left;
}
.msg{
	width:547px;
	height:auto;
	overflow:hidden;
	margin-top:15px;
	
}
.msg .tops{
	width:100%;
	height:12px;
	background:url(../images/about_4_r6_c6.jpg) no-repeat;
}
.msg .cons{
	width:545;
	height:220px;
	_margin-top:-8px;
	background:#F0F0F0;
	border-left:1px solid #918F9A;
	border-right:1px solid #918F9A;
}
.msg .cons1{
	width:545;
	height:50px;
	border-left:1px solid #918F9A;
	border-right:1px solid #918F9A;
}
.msg .bots{
	width:100%;
	height:12px;
	background:url(../images/about_4_r7_c6.jpg) no-repeat;
}
.newslist{
	width:680px; height:200px; margin:0 auto; border:0px solid red;margin-top:25px;
}
.newslist .img{
	width:221px;
	height:106px;
	float: left;
}
.newslist .ri{
	width:470px;
	height:114px;
	float: right;
	border:0px solid red;

}
.newslist span{
	font-size:14px;
	font-weight:bold;
}

.newslist .moer{
	width:680px;
	height:50px;
	text-align:right;
	border-bottom:1px dashed #918F9A;
	clear:both;
}
.newslist .moer img{
	float:right;
}
/*no border*/
.newslistnoborder{
	width:680px; height:200px; margin:0 auto; border:0px solid red;margin-top:25px;
}
.newslistnoborder .img{
	width:221px;
	height:106px;
	float: left;
}
.newslistnoborder .ri{
	width:470px;
	height:114px;
	float: right;
	border:0px solid red;

}
.newslistnoborder span{
	font-size:14px;
	font-weight:bold;
}

.newslistnoborder .moer{
	width:680px;
	height:50px;
	text-align:right;
	clear:both;
}
/*=====================Menu Style Beg========================*/
.lavaLampNoImage {
	position:relative;
	height:25px;
	margin:0px 0px;
	width:auto;
	margin-left:20px;
}
.lavaLampNoImage li {
	float: left;
	list-style: none;
}
.lavaLampNoImage li.back {
	background:url(../images/menubg.gif) no-repeat center;
	width:90px;
	height:20px;
	margin-top:6px;
	padding-top:3px;
	z-index:9;
	position:absolute;
}
.lavaLampNoImage li a {
	font: bold 12px arial;
	text-decoration: none;
	color: #FFFFFF;
	outline: none;
	font-family:宋体;
	text-align: center;
	top:10px;
	text-transform: uppercase;
	letter-spacing: 0;
	z-index: 10;
	display: block;
	float: left;
	height:30px;
	position: relative;
	overflow: hidden;
	margin: auto 10px;
}
.lavaLampNoImage li a:hover{
	color:#FFFFFF;
}
.lavaLampNoImage li a:hover, .lavaLampNoImage li a:active, .lavaLampNoImage li a:visited {
	border: none;
}
/*=====================Menu Style End========================*/


.zd_cen{
	width:928px;height:auto; overflow:hidden; border:0px solid red;
}
.zd_top{
	width:927px;border:1px solid #E1E1E1; height:80px;float:right;
	margin-top:20px;
}
.zd_img{
	border-right:1px solid #E1E1E1; width:233px; height:100%;float:left;
}
.zd_img img{
	margin:0 auto;margin-top:20px;
}
.zd_img div{
	width:200px; height:auto; overflow:hidden; margin:0 auto;margin-top:20px;
}


.mttop{height:30px;width:930px;margin-top:20px;}
.mttop div{width:231px;height:30px;float:left; border:0px solid red;
background:url(../images/pu.png) no-repeat;
background-position:0px -141px;
margin-left:2px;
color:#FFFFFF;
font-weight: bold;
text-align:center;
line-height:30px;
cursor:pointer;
}
.nobg{
background:none;
color:#000000;
}

#tabcontent1,#tabcontent2,#tabcontent3,#tabcontent4,#anothercontent1,#anothercontent2, #anothercontent3, #anothercontent4,#anothercontent5, #anothercontent6 {
	width:928px;height:400px;background:#F2F2F2; border-right:1px solid #E1E1E1; border-left:1px solid #E1E1E1;
}
.titles{
border:1px solid red; width:200px;
}
.icons{
background:url(../images/icon.png) no-repeat;
width:15px;height:15px;padding-left:20px;
}